A: After 21:30, the front entrance of the Bramblewick office is sealed and reception is unstaffed, so all night-shift support staff at Quillon Analytics must use the north stairwell entrance beside the loading bay. Badge in at the outer gate first, then proceed to the stairwell door, which is fitted with a keypad. Make sure the door closes fully behind you, and never hold it open for anyone you cannot identify. The current keypad code for the night rotation is shown below.

turnstile pass: bdg-TXR-4

The Slatewick solver endpoint accepts a constraint bundle describing rooms, teachers, and period blocks, then returns a ranked set of feasible timetables for the requesting school. Note that partial bundles are rejected rather than padded with defaults. All solver calls route through the Marrowgate internal gateway, which authenticates using the key that follows.

API key for tagef-fafop: vxb2-ta

Ticket: Vault locked during hermetic build migration

While migrating the Ostrell build to the new hermetic toolchain (Forgekit), the secrets vault used by the legacy pipeline auto-locked after three failed fetches. The hermetic build no longer mounts ambient credentials, which is expected, but the old pipeline still needs vault access until cutover completes next week. Reviewer: please confirm the fetch retries are capped in the new config. To unlock the legacy vault for the interim, use this passphrase:

vault phrase of bagaf-kajeg = jorath-feniel-briir-siliel-ralix

## Rate Limiting in the Corvid Gateway

The Corvid internal gateway enforces per-service limits: 100 requests per second, with bursts up to 250. When a caller exceeds this, the gateway returns a retry-after header; advise customers to honor it. Support tooling gets an elevated quota. Authenticate your support console using the key below.

app token of yajeg-kawef = kto11_7En3XSX8xQw